If you’re a Capital One guaranteed card client, your bank checking account might be emptied.

Additionally, secured card customers have actually low fico scores – the normal customer’s FICO is when you look at the 500s — an evident indication that they’ve struggled into the previous to pay bills also to pay the bills. This disorder may be short-term —your credit score might remain low despite the fact that finances have actually restored, since missed re re payments reduce your credit history for seven years — but the majority of Us americans who struggle economically never attain the stability they’d have to keep a credit score that is high. In a nation where a good amount of individuals reside paycheck-to-paycheck, but just a third have subprime payday loans SD credit ratings, guaranteed card holders and candidates are under genuine distress that is financial.

Because guaranteed card candidates need to put a security deposit down, they’re maybe not authorized until they give Capital One checking or family savings information and their deposit is delivered, unlike users of unsecured cards. This is just what places Capital One’s guaranteed card holders at risk that is greatest following the breach.

Home Loans For Single Moms: 3 Ways that is alternative to A House

Being an individual mom is a tough task. As being a solitary mom, you’re not just accountable for your youngster (or kiddies), also for all your household’s financial matters. Juggling most of these obligations is really a challenge, to put it mildly. For all solitary mothers, homeownership might appear as a dream that is unachievable the good thing is this really isn’t true. Simply as you don’t have the monetary help of the partner does not suggest you can’t purchase a property to improve your household in. We provide you helpful tips for getting a mortgage loan as a single mom in order that you can easily reach your imagine house ownership.

Get Yourself Ready For Advance Payment

Clearly, picking out a deposit is easier whenever a family group has a couple making earnings. For solitary moms, making an advance payment for|payment that is down a traditional loan may possibly not be economically feasible, particularly because the median down payment for first-time homebuyers in 2018 had been 7 %, in accordance with a study by NAR (National Association of Realtors). Luckily, as an individual mom, maybe you are in a position to make use of a payment assistance program that is down.
